Figure 2. Visual cycle genes expressed in retinal pigment epithelium

The Protein Lounge database was used to identify cycle members. Some mRNAs for visual cycle proteins increased throughout development, others only during the late phase when photoreceptor outer segments are forming. The apparent variation of interphotoreceptor retinoid binding protein (IRBP) was statistically insignificant. Low signals with large statistical errors typified the few genes that are not expressed by retinal pigment epithelium, but were detected on the microarray. Mean values of 3-4 biological replicates are indicated according to the scale, in arbitrary units, depicted at the bottom.
